Ethics in psychology classes refers to the teaching and discussion of ethical principles and guidelines within the field of psychology.
Key Features
- Introduction to ethical principles in psychology
- Discussion of ethical dilemmas and case studies
- Exploration of ethical standards set by professional organizations such as APA
- Emphasis on respecting confidentiality, informed consent, and avoiding harm to participants
Pros
- Promotes ethical behavior in future psychologists
- Raises awareness of potential ethical issues in research and practice
- Encourages critical thinking and ethical decision-making
Cons
- May be challenging for some students to grasp complex ethical concepts
- Can be time-consuming to thoroughly cover all aspects of ethics in psychology
